Proteins that are embedded within, and extend across, the phospholipid bilayer are called _____ proteins. rev: 02_22_2014_qc_455
brilliants [131]

Proteins that are embedded within, and extend across, the phospholipid bilayer are called <u>Integral Protein</u>.

Integral Protein- Any protein containing a unique functional area for the purpose of ensuring its location within the cellular membrane is referred to as an integral protein, which is also referred to as an integral membrane protein. Or, to put it another way, an integral protein seizes the cellular membrane.

Cellular membrane- All cells have a cell membrane, also known as a plasma membrane, which divides the inside of the cell from the external environment. A semipermeable lipid bilayer makes up the cell membrane. The movement of materials into and out of the cell is controlled by the cell membrane.

Which of the following is the correct order in which toxic nitrogen compounds are converted to less toxic nitrogen compounds in
alex41 [277]

The order in which toxic nitrogen compounds are converted to less toxic nitrogen compounds in the nitrogen cycle is NH3 ----> NO2-   -----> NO3-

The nitrogen cycle refers to the movement of nitrogen in the ecosystem. The process of converting nitrogen into less toxic forms of nitrogen which is useful to plants is called nitrification.

During the process of nitrification, ammonia or ammonium is first converted to nitrates by the action of the microorganism called nitrosomonas. Nitrobacter converts nitrites to nitrates which are useful to plants.

Hence, the order in which toxic nitrogen compounds are converted to less toxic nitrogen compounds in the nitrogen cycle is NH3 ----> NO2-   -----> NO3-
